Surroundings:
De Pijp is known for its vibrancy, diversity and rich history. Once a working-class neighborhood, De Pijp is now one of the most dynamic and diverse neighborhoods in Amsterdam. What makes De Pijp so special is the mix of cultures, nationalities and lifestyles that come together here. The neighborhood offers an abundance of cozy cafes, trendy restaurants, boutiques, markets and art galleries. The Albert Cuypmarkt, one of the largest daily markets in Europe, is a well-known attraction where visitors can find everything from fresh produce to clothing and souvenirs. Besides the bustling streets and markets, De Pijp also offers green oases such as the Sarphatipark, where residents and visitors can relax and enjoy nature.

Accessibility and amenities:
Ferdinand Bolstraat is well served by streetcar lines, including streetcar 3 and streetcar 12, which offer quick connections to other parts of the city. There are also several bus stops nearby. The A10 ring road connects several highways and provides access to other parts of the city and beyond. Exits S108 and S109 are closest to Ferdinand Bolstraat and offer connections to the northern and southern parts of the city.

Along Ferdinand Bolstraat is a diverse array of stores, boutiques and eateries offering a wide range of products and culinary experiences. From local cafes to international restaurants, the street attracts residents and visitors alike with its diversity of options.
